Microsoft laid off over 200 employees at Xbox amid the company’s shift away from a failed streaming gaming strategy. The move signals a significant change in Xbox’s approach to cloud gaming and future investments.

Microsoft has laid off over 200 employees at Xbox, a move officially attributed to restructuring efforts. The layoffs are linked to the company’s failed streaming gaming strategy, which aimed to position Xbox as a leader in cloud gaming but did not meet expectations, according to sources familiar with the matter.

The layoffs, reported by Bloomberg and confirmed by Microsoft spokespersons, are part of a broader effort to realign Xbox’s focus away from streaming services that did not deliver anticipated growth. Microsoft invested heavily in cloud gaming infrastructure and partnerships, including with Xbox Cloud Gaming (xCloud), but these initiatives failed to gain the competitive edge expected in the market.

Sources indicate that the streaming strategy was a central component of Xbox’s long-term vision, but it faced technical challenges, limited user adoption, and stiff competition from Sony and other cloud gaming providers. The layoffs primarily affected teams working on cloud infrastructure and streaming content, reflecting a strategic pivot back toward traditional gaming hardware and software development.

Background of Xbox’s Cloud Gaming Ambitions and Setbacks

Microsoft announced its cloud gaming ambitions as part of its broader Xbox strategy in 2020, investing billions into infrastructure and partnerships to rival Sony and Tencent. Despite significant investments, the service struggled with technical issues, limited adoption, and stiff competition. The company’s focus on streaming was seen as a key component of its future, but recent internal reports and industry analysis indicate the strategy did not meet expectations, leading to restructuring and layoffs in early 2024. Prior to these layoffs, Microsoft had publicly emphasized cloud gaming as a growth area, but internal challenges persisted.
